CP Radhakrishnan to be the country's Vice President, receives 452 votes, Sudarshan Reddy gets 300 votes
Radhakrishnan received 452 first-preference votes, while the opposition's candidate, former Justice B Sudarshan Reddy, secured 300 votes.
Voting for the Vice Presidential election took place from 10 AM to 5 PM today in the Parliament building.
Rajya Sabha Secretary General and Returning Officer PC Modi said, "The NDA candidate and Governor of Maharashtra, C.P. Radhakrishnan, received 452 first-preference votes. He has been elected as the Vice President of India. The opposition's candidate for the Vice Presidential post, B. Sudarshan Reddy, received 300 first-preference votes."
Voting for the Vice Presidential election began at 10 AM on Tuesday and ended at 5 PM. Prime Minister Narendra Modi, Leader of Opposition in Lok Sabha Rahul Gandhi, Home Minister Amit Shah, Defence Minister Rajnath Singh, Congress Parliamentary Party chief Sonia Gandhi, Congress President Mallikarjun Kharge, former Prime Minister HD Deve Gowda, Akhilesh Yadav, along with 766 MPs cast their votes. One MP voted via postal ballot. Members of Lok Sabha and Rajya Sabha participate in this election, and no whip is issued in it.
For the election of the 17th Vice President of the country, the electoral college consists of 233 elected members of Rajya Sabha (currently five seats are vacant) and 12 nominated members, as well as 543 elected members of Lok Sabha (currently one seat is vacant). The electoral college has a total of 788 members (currently 781). Biju Janata Dal (BJD), Bharat Rashtra Samithi (BRS), and Shiromani Akali Dal (SAD) had decided to stay away from the election.
